Angus Glen Canada Day Five Miler
Angus Glen Golf and Country Club once again played host to another fantastic Raceworks event. The Angus Glen Series (Half Marathon, Spring
10 Miler the latest Canada Day 5 miler and the upcoming Harvest Ride in October) is becoming one the premier series of races in this part of Ontario. The Half Marathon is always sold out and as more people find out how great and safe this course is, they will be selling out every event.
Sara, David, the volunteers and of course the World Class staff of Angus Glen helped make the event a flawless and well organized affair. Add in an absolutely perfect evening for running and you have another slam dunk perfect event.
The next Raceworks event is in a beautiful little town called Minden. It`s for a great cause and an absolute treat to cover. Congrats to all the finishers yesterday! From first to last, everyone had a smile, kind words and had a terrific time!
